Description

Stress Corrosion Cracking: Theory and Practice, Second Edition provides a cutting-edge overview of the stress corrosion cracking (SCC) field as well as numerous case studies in over ten different industries (such as refineries and biomaterials) to aid corrosion researchers and engineers in their work. This updated edition has been revised to include new insights on SCC prevention technologies, electrochemical aspects of SCC, hydrogen permeation and related techniques, and SCC in a variety of materials and settings, including high strength steels, ceramics and glasses, biomaterials, and more. Particular emphasis is placed on the role of hydrogen in metal deformation behavior. Author Biography:

Prof. V.S Raja received his doctorate from the Indian Institute of Science in Bangalore in 1987, then joined the faculty at the Indian Institute of Technology in Bombay, where he is now the Institute Chair Professor in the Department of Metallurgical Engineering and Materials Science. His research focuses broadly on the field of corrosion. He worked as a guest researcher at Chalmers University of Technology in Sweden, as a Visiting Professor at the University of Nevada in the United States, and as a Guest Scientist at GKSS in Germany and Tohoku University in Japan. He is currently working on numerous corrosion-related challenges in Canada, France, Australia, Belgium, and the Netherlands. He is a member of the CSIR and DRDO laboratories' Research Councils, and he sat on the NACE international research committee from 2009 to 2013. He has garnered multiple national accolades and is a NACE fellow as a result of his efforts.
